Wellington Heights Secondary School hosted the Wellington North and Southgate Job Fair in the school gymnasium on Wednesday, April 15, 2026. 38 exhibitors from across the Wellington North and Southgate region attended the job fair, which was visited by nearly 500 students and community members. The event was organized by WHSS teacher, Matt Timberlake, in collaboration with Robyn Mulder from the Township of Wellington North, Brenna Carroll from Southgate Township, and Kelly Schafer and Sadia Batool from the Career Education Council.
